Deanndra Hall is a working writer living in far western Kentucky. A free spirit and chronic jokester, she and her partner of over 30 years enjoy visiting their two adult children and their partners and playing with their three crazy little dogs. When she's not writing, Deanndra can be found kayaking, working out at the gym, cooking something healthy, or reading. After writing for business, industry, academia, and non-profits for years and having her work credited to others, she jumped into the fiction realm, particularly erotic fiction and erotica, and had so much fun she never looked back. 4.25stars--A TWISTED MAN is the fourth instalment in Deanndra Hall’s contemporary, adult APPALACHIAN STAR erotic , romantic suspense set in the multi-authored Special Forces: Operation Alpha series with characters first introduced in author Susan Stoker’s series. This is thirty-nine year Kevin ‘Bulldog’ Wade, and hairdresser Tinsley Hancock’s story line. A TWISTED MAN can be read as a stand alone without any difficulty. Any important information from the previous story lines is revealed where necessary. BULLDOG’S story has been building throughout the series.
SOME BACKGROUND: Appalachian STAR is a search and rescue operation set in the mountains of eastern Kentucky, an operation that hires former inmates form the US prison system.
Told from dual first person perspectives (Kevin and Tinsley) A TWISTED MAN follows the building but tempestuous relationship between Kevin and Tinsley. Kevin ‘Bulldog’ Wade served eight years in prison for a crime he did not commit. Upon his release Kevin was angry, obnoxious, obstinate and humiliated, so much so, that he directed his anger at everyone else including our story line heroine. Tinsley Hancock did not deserve the vitriol thrown at her by Kevin Wade, but our hero has struggled in the wake of losing everything and everyone he has loved. Making apologies and accepting his fate is only the beginning for Kevin; working for Appalachian STAR is another start but the past is about to resurface, taking aim at the woman with whom he is falling in love. What ensues is the building relationship between Kevin and Tinsley, and the potential fall-out as past demands everything, leaving our heroine unprotected from the sins of Kevin’s past.
The world building continues to focus on the men and women at Appalachian STAR. The man in charge, Patrick ‘Patch’ Scott is about to face a loss he never expected, and in doing so, bring home the family he thought he would never see again. As Kevin works at becoming a new man, the past refuses to let go, sending Kevin into a spiral from which he may never come home.
The relationship between Kevin and Tinsley begins acrimoniously. Kevin is emotionally aggressive towards our story line heroine but Tinsley refuses to back from the man with whom she will fall in love. Several attempts at reconciliation and apologies pull our couple together, a pull that is threatened, once again, by demons from the past.
